Driver for NVIDIA NVIDIA RTX A4000 - downloading and installing it


NVIDIA RTX A4000 is a Display Adapters hardware device. This driver was developed by NVIDIA. The hardware id of this driver is PCI/VEN_10DE&DEV_24B0&SUBSYS_14AD10DE; this string has to match your hardware.
